Key Terms
- Photosynthesis: Process by which green plants use sunlight, water, and carbon dioxide to create their own food (sugars) and release oxygen.
- Respiration: Process where plants break down sugars to release energy for growth and other life processes, consuming oxygen and releasing carbon dioxide.
- Transpiration: The process of water movement through a plant and its evaporation from aerial parts, such as leaves, stems and flowers.
- Stomata: Pores on the surface of leaves and stems that control gas exchange (CO2 in, O2 out) and water vapor release.
- Xylem: Plant tissue that transports water and some nutrients from the roots to the rest of the plant.
- Phloem: Plant tissue that transports sugars (food) produced during photosynthesis from the leaves to other parts of the plant.
- Primary Growth: Growth in length of roots and shoots, occurring at apical meristems.
- Secondary Growth: Growth in thickness or diameter of stems and roots, occurring at lateral meristems (cambium).
- Imperfect Flower: A flower that has either male (stamens) or female (pistil) reproductive organs, but not both.
- Perfect Flower: A flower that contains both male (stamens) and female (pistil) reproductive organs.
- Photoperiodism: The physiological response of organisms to variations in day or night length.
- Macronutrients: Essential nutrients required by plants in relatively large quantities (e.g., Nitrogen, Phosphorus, Potassium).

Myth vs Reality
- All plants can be propagated easily by seed.: Some plants are difficult to grow from seed or do not come true to type, requiring vegetative propagation methods.
- Pesticides are the only way to control greenhouse pests.: Integrated Pest Management (IPM) combines biological, cultural, and chemical controls for a more sustainable approach.
- Healthy soil is simply dirt with some added fertilizer.: Healthy soil is a living ecosystem with balanced nutrients, good structure, and beneficial microorganisms.
Real World Examples
- Propagating tomatoes: Typically grown from seed due to ease and genetic consistency.
- Propagating geraniums: Easily propagated from stem cuttings.
- Propagating irises: Propagated by dividing rhizomes.
- Propagating potatoes: Propagated using tubers (seed potatoes).
- Aphid infestation in a greenhouse: Control with ladybugs (beneficial insects) or insecticidal soap.
- Spider mite outbreak: Managed by increasing humidity and using predatory mites.
